Topics Covered
- 1. Introduction to Predictive Modeling: Learners will understand the basics of predictive modeling, including types of models, data preparation, and model evaluation metrics. They will gain foundational knowledge to identify appropriate models for trend analysis.
- 2. Data Exploration and Preprocessing: This module covers techniques for exploring and preprocessing data to make it suitable for modeling. Learners will learn to handle missing values, outliers, and data normalization, enhancing their ability to prepare robust datasets.
- 3. Regression Models for Trend Analysis: Learners will study linear and nonlinear regression models, learning how to apply these models to forecast trends based on historical data. Practical skills include model selection, parameter tuning, and interpreting regression outputs.
- 4. Time Series Analysis: This module focuses on analyzing time series data to identify patterns and trends over time. Learners will gain expertise in using decomposition, moving averages, and seasonal adjustment techniques.
- 5. Machine Learning Basics: An introduction to machine learning concepts, including supervised and unsupervised learning. Learners will explore basic algorithms and understand how they can be applied to predictive modeling for trend analysis.
- 6. Advanced Regression Techniques: In-depth study of advanced regression techniques such as polynomial regression, ridge regression, and lasso regression. Learners will learn how to apply these techniques to improve model accuracy and handle multicollinearity.
- 7. Ensemble Methods: This module covers ensemble methods including random forests and gradient boosting. Learners will understand how to combine multiple models to enhance predictive power and reduce variance.
- 8. Model Validation and Testing: Focused on validating and testing models to ensure they perform well on unseen data. Learners will learn about cross-validation, bootstrapping, and other validation techniques to build reliable models.
- 9. Trend Analysis Case Studies: Real-world case studies where learners apply predictive modeling techniques to analyze trends in various industries, such as finance, retail, and technology. They will gain practical experience in solving complex business problems.
- 10. Implementation and Reporting: This final module teaches learners how to implement predictive models in real-world scenarios and how to effectively communicate their findings through reports and presentations. They will learn best practices for model deployment and maintenance.
